Can you describe the pain of an insect bite? A new book could help.

Science

Do you remember the last time you were stung by a honeybee? Would you say that it felt “burning and corrosive?” Or more like “a flaming match head quenched first by lye, then by sulfuric acid?” Could you assign the pain a numerical value? A new book ranks the pain associated with bee and ant stings and provides helpfully poetic ways of describing them.
